Residents are warned about bogus workman

-

POLICE in Stockport have issued a warning to residents about a bogus workman operating in the borough.

The man has been reported as targeting elderly people in the area and asking them to pay up front for tree or garden work ‘with no intention of carrying out said work’.

According to a warning published on the GMP Stockport Facebook page, the offender is described as a white male, around 5ft 8in tall, of slim build, around 50 years old with short dark hair, clean shaven and with a long, thin face.

He also spoke with an Irish accent.

In one particular incident, when an elderly woman was targeted, he was wearing a mid-green jacket and matching trousers with a logo on the left chest area.

The logo was described as two letters in gold on a brown background.

Anyone with any informatio­n is asked to contact the police on 101 or Crimestopp­ers, anonymousl­y, on 0800 555 111.
